Eight European nations (Denmark, Finland, France, Germany, Italy, the Netherlands, Sweden, and the UK) have notified the UN that they have destroyed 3.5 million surplus infantry weapons. The UN had asked all member states to destroy surplus rifles, pistols, and machineguns rather than see them end up in the hands of warring factions or criminal syndicates.--Stephen V Cole
